Use the image to answer the question.

An illustration shows two parallel slanting lines m and l intersecting a vertical line k. The angles formed at the intersection of lines l and k are 1, 2, 4, and 3. The angles 1 and 4 are opposite to each other while angles 2 and 3 are opposite to each other. The angles formed at the intersection of lines m and k are 5, 6, 8, and 7. The angles 5 and 8 are opposite to each other while angles 6 and 7 are opposite to each other.

If m∠6=140°
, what is m∠7
?

To solve for \( m∠7 \), we can use the property of vertically opposite angles and the fact that angles on a straight line sum up to \( 180° \).

Given:

  • \( m∠6 = 140° \)

Since angles \( 6 \) and \( 7 \) are vertically opposite angles, they are equal: \[ m∠7 = m∠6 = 140° \]

Therefore, the measure of angle \( 7 \) is

\[ \boxed{140°}. \]
